    Rice University - Rice Cinema presents the Mexican Film Series: Contemporary Selections, September 23-25, 2011.

    Schedule of Films:

    Sept. 23 6:30 PM

    SPIRAL (Espiral)
    The Mexican Film series continues this weekend with SPIRAL (Espiral), (2009, 100 min, Mexico) directed by Jorge Perez Solano. Prior to the screening, there will be a discussion from 6:30-7:00 with the film beginning promptly at 7:00 p.m.
    Hoping to better their lives, men migrate without realizing they are destroying what they most want to protect: their families. The men return to find nothing is the same since the women have taken over, fending for themselves without men. A distinctly Mixteca take on the human condition and how dreams sometimes distract us from the miracles that surround us. This luscious tragi-comedy will have you laughing to keep from crying one moment and con lagrimas de risa the next.

    Sept. 24 7:00 PM
    7 DAYS 
    The Mexican Film series continues with "7 Days" (7 Di´as), (2005, 194 min, Mexico) directed by Fernando Kalife.
    "7 Days" is the story of desperate Claudio Caballero, a man who lives in the shadow of how great an event organizer his dead brother was. Claudio convinces his girlfriend Gloria to lend him $500,000 to place a suicidal bet at a clandestine casino, believing he'll walk out with the budget to bring the best rock act in the world to his hometown. He fails, but is given an unexpected last chance.

    Sept. 25 7:00 PM
    THE STUDENT
    The Mexican Film Series concludes with "The Student" (El estudiante") (2009, 95 min, Mexico). directed by Roberto Girault.
    After retiring to the beautiful Mexican town of Guanajuato, a 70 year old decides to follow his dreams and enroll at the university where he stumbles upon a new generation and they are bound together by the novel Don Quijote de la Mancha.
